Reasons To Invest In Hardwood Refinishing For Your Home's Flooring

Posted on: 2 July 2021

When your home comes with original wood floors, you want to take the best care of them. However, like any other type of flooring material, the wood from which they are made can suffer wear, tear, and other damage. 

To help them look their best, you need to know how to take care of them. You can start by using hardwood refinishing to protect the appearance, value, and integrity of your wood floors.

Maintaining Original Color

When you use hardwood refinishing on your floors, you can protect and maintain their original color. The color of your wood floors can fade after a few years. They can especially become discolored if they are exposed to sunlight and harsh chemicals like bleach.

To minimize the loss of color in your floors, you can use hardwood refinishing on them. It seals in the floors' color, protects it from fading, and ensures that your floors look just as vibrant and appealing as when they were first installed.

Protecting from Scratches and Gouges

Original wood floors are also prone to damage like scratches and gouges that can ruin their appearance and value. When your floors sustain this kind of damage, they can be difficult to repair without having to spend a significant amount of money to sand and stain them again.

Rather than put out substantial sums of money for repairs, you can protect your wood floors with hardwood refinishing. This measure will provide a layer of protection on the surface of your floors, shield them from gouges and scratches and save you money on repairs.

Ensuring Longevity and Value

Finally, hardwood refinishing can ensure the longevity and value of your home's original wood floors. If you were to leave them unprotected, you could cause the floors to weaken and develop a dingy and unappealing look. They could actually detract from your home's overall value instead of being an asset to it as intended.

By using hardwood refinishing on them, you strengthen their integrity and shield them from unsightly deterioration that can make them be a detriment rather than an asset. They can positively contribute to the overall beauty and value of your home.
